What is an Online Memorial?

An online memorial is a mini website on the internet, dedicated to your loved one. The site contains features such as:

  1. Ability to Post Photographs
  2. Ability to Post Audio Clips / Video Clips
  3. Background Music
  4. Life Story
  5. Timeline
  6. Light a Candle
  7. Tributes and Condolences
  8. Memories
Online memorials are not meant to replace traditional methods of remembrance and memorialization such as headstones and obituaries, but rather offer an additional means of remembering lost loved ones.

Who creates a Memorial Website?

Memorial Websites can be created by a wide range of people, from close relatives of the deceased, to friends and colleagues of the deceased. The creator of the site can use our "tell your friends" feature to notify others of the Memorial Website’s existence so that they can view the tribute and leave their own tributes and messages of condolence.

Why create a Memorial Website?

There are many reasons why someone would want to create a Memorial Website, but perhaps the most important one for many people is that they want their loved ones to be remembered forever. Creating a Memorial online gives them the opportunity to make sure that the lives of those who have passed away will never be forgotten.

Most users who create an online memorial describe the process as therapeutic as it can often help with the bereavement process to write memories, stories and messages to their loved ones down. By putting these things onto a Memorial Website, the creator of the tribute can truly reflect upon the person’s life and will also become part of a community of people who are all dealing with grief. This is very important as most people who have lost someone they care for can initially feel quite isolated and may need someone to talk to who understands exactly what they are going through.

How can somebody access my Online Memorial?

Each Memorial Website is given a unique website address (e.g. www.remembered-forever.org /johnsmith). This allows the user to go straight to the online memorial by simply entering the unique address into the address bar.

This address can be given out to family members and friends, who will then also be able to go straight to the Memorial Website.

Alternatively, the tribute can be searched for by using the search feature on www.remembered-forever.org. Simply type in the deceased’s first name, surname or both and you will be taken to a list of online memorials which match that criterion.

This means that the public also have access to your Memorial Website, which allows them to view it and offer their own condolences.

What if I don’t want the public to view my Memorial Website?

Although it can be beneficial to share your loved ones’ story with others, we understand that some people would rather keep their tributes private from the public. When creating your memorial you will be given the option to either have it displayed to the public or to have it password protected.

If you choose to have the Memorial password protected, users will need to enter a password of your choice before they can access the site. You can give the password out to as many or as few people as you like, meaning that you can restrict access to only family and close friends if you choose to do so.

How long does it take to create an Online Memorial?

Creating a Memorial Website takes a matter of minutes. Once you have filled in a form with a few details about yourself and about the deceased, then that is the memorial created. However, most people like to then edit the site and add photographs, audio clips and the life story of the person who has passed away. This means that you can spend as little or as much time as you like editing and adding things to the online memorial.
